Output 6af0cda51bb528720c74da2326a118c1bbf491e12809db884189043f7e359744:2

value
25085534
script pubkey
OP_0 OP_PUSHBYTES_20 70d4174cf95a08ba65091712375fea0233292f05
address
ltc1qwr2pwn8etgyt5egfzufrwhl2qgejjtc949cnc6
transaction
6af0cda51bb528720c74da2326a118c1bbf491e12809db884189043f7e359744
spent
true